118 Strathallan Blvd., Toronto
Asking price: $4,249,000 (April, 2026)
Previous asking prices: $4,695,000 (May, 2025); $4,995,000 (March, 2025); $5,295,000 (February, 2025)
Selling price: $4,305,118 (May, 2026)
Previous selling price: $610,000 (July, 1991)
Taxes: $19,551 (2026)
Property days on market: 176
Listing agents: Carol Lome and Brayden Irwin, Royal LePage Real Estate Services Ltd., Johnston and Daniel Division

The action
This three-storey, six-bedroom house has many family-friendly assets, including Lytton Park at the end of the street. But agent Brayden Irwin was surprised by the lack of response when it first hit the market in February, 2025. Two hefty price cuts also failed to stir buyers.
“It’s on one of the premier streets in Lytton Park,” said Mr. Irwin. “It doesn’t get a lot of traffic, and it’s in the John Ross school district, which is the main attraction.
“Looking back now, it wasn’t clear where the market was for a home of this stature. Sales slowed to a crawl for the better part of last year.”
The owners took the home off the market last summer, but the sale of a few homes in the area that fetched between $4-million and $5-million convinced them to try again, with updated staging, more seasonally appropriate (snow-free) photographs and a new asking price under $4.25-million. Within four days, they received two offers, and a deal at $4,305,118.
“We were optimistic, based on recent sales, but you never know how it’s going to be received,” Mr. Irwin said.
“We had strong activity right off the bat and ultimately ended up getting two offers.”

What they got
The detached house was built on a 50- by 133-foot lot around 100 years ago.
In the 1990s, it was renovated and expanded to deliver 5,542 square feet of living space, including two recreation areas in the basement.
The main floor has a living room with a wood-burning fireplace and a family room with coffered ceilings.
There are five bathrooms, a dining room and a kitchen with French doors to the patio and a double garage.

The agent’s take
“It was larger than most older homes with additions put on them,” Mr. Irwin said.
“The renovations these clients did were top-of-the-line.”
